Overview

BlenderTM is a free Open-Source 3D Computer Modeling and Animation Suite incorporating Character Rigging, Particles, Real World Physics Simulation, Sculpting, Video Editing with Motion Tracking and 2D Animation within the 3D Environment. Blender is FREE to download and use by anyone for anything. The Complete Guide to Blender Graphics: Computer Modeling and Animation, Eighth Edition is a unified manual describing the operation of the program, updated with reference to the Graphical User Interface for Blender Version 3.2.2, including additional material covering Blender Assets, Geometry Nodes, and Non-Linear Animation. Divided into a two-volume set, the book introduces the program’s Graphical User Interface and shows how to implement tools for modeling and animating characters and created scenes with the application of color, texture, and special lighting effects. Key Features: The book provides instruction for New Users starting at the very beginning Instruction is presented in a series of chapters incorporating visual reference to the program's interface The initial chapters are designed to instruct the user in the operation of the program while introducing and demonstrating interesting features of the program Chapters are developed in a building block fashion providing forward and reverse reference to relevant material Both volumes are available in a discounted set, which can also be purchased together with Blender 2D Animation: The Complete Guide to the Grease Pencil.

Table of Contents

Introduction. Download and Installation. The Author. Preamble. CH01 Understanding the Interface. CH02 Editors-Workspaces-Themes. CH03 Navigate and Save. CH04 Objects in the 3D View Editor. CH05 Editing Objects. CH06 Editing Tools. CH07 Editing with Modifiers. CH08 Editing Techniques- Examples. CH09 Materials- Textures- Nodes. CH10 Textures. CH11 Node Systems and Usage. CH12 Scene Lighting & Cameras. CH13 Viewport Shading. CH14 Rendering. CH15 Animation. CH16 Armatures & Character Rigging. CH17 3D Text. CH18 Blender Assets. CH19 Making a Movie. CH20 The Outliner and Collections. Index.

Author Information

John M. Blain has become a recognised expert in Blender having seven successful prior editions of this book to date. John became enthused with Blender on retirement from a career in Mechanical Engineering. The Complete Guide to Blender Graphics originated from personal notes compiled in the course of self learning. The notes were recognised as an ideal instruction source by Neal Hirsig, Senior Lecturer (Retired) at Tufts University. Neal encouraged publication of the First Edition and in doing so is deserving of the author's gratitude.
